The HubSpot Services Strategy and Operations Team is looking for a Program Manager to work toward improving Customer Success. This individual is responsible for creating program goals, plans, and/or driving execution. They should have superb people skills to cultivate and develop trust and communication across various stakeholders. In this role you will be responsible for developing and executing scalable business programs through process engineering and communication of information. This is critical to enable continuous innovation and growth of our customers.

The ideal candidate is a change agent, comfortable with a dynamic environment and can shift readily between ‘big-picture’ and small-but-critical details, knowing when to appropriate time and concentrate on each. You are a collaborative problem solver that looks for high-leverage areas of the business to use data to create and present recommendations for business process improvements. Additionally, you are excited about developing, improving and following process and eager to learn the ins and outs of SAAS through exposure to change management.

Responsibilities Include:

  • Create efficient processes to enable scalable customer success
  • Work closely with Services leadership to form and scale customer success programs
  • Ability to learn quickly, thoroughly, and on-the-job
  • Preparation and presentation at team all-hands meetings

Skills:

  • Extremely organized self-starter who possesses the intellectual curiosity to solve problems
  • Detail oriented / on-time delivery / comfortable creating materials for business leaders
  • Ability to get stakeholder buy-in and cultivate trust among various organizations
  • Ability to learn quickly
  • Ability to drive programs quickly and thoroughly
  • Logical, statistical thinker
  • Excel knowledge preferred; data base knowledge a plus
  • Excellent analytical and communication skills
  • 3+ years of relevant experience
  • MBA preferred
  • Presentation skills

About HubSpot

HubSpot helps millions of organizations grow better, and we’d love to grow better with you. Our business builds the software and systems that power the world’s small to medium-sized businesses. Our company culture builds connections, careers, and employee growth. How? By creating a workplace that values flexibility, autonomy, and transparency. If that sounds like something you’d like to be part of, we’d love to hear from you.

You can find out more about our company culture in the HubSpot Culture Code, which has more than 3M views, and learn about our commitment to creating a diverse and inclusive workplace, too. Thanks to the work of every HubSpotter globally who has helped build our remarkable culture, HubSpot has been named a top workplace by Glassdoor, Fortune, Entrepreneur, and more.

HubSpot was founded in 2006. We’re headquartered in Cambridge, Massachusetts, and we have offices in Dublin (Ireland), Sydney (Australia), New Hampshire, Singapore, Tokyo (Japan), Berlin (Germany), and Bogotá (Colombia).
